不同NDF水平开食料对羔羊生长轴及十二指肠生长相关基因表达的影响  

Effect of Different NDF Levels of Starter on Growth Axis and Duodenum-Related Gene Expression in Lambs

摘  要:旨在研究不同NDF水平开食料对羔羊生长轴及十二指肠生长相关基因表达的影响,以期为羔羊开食料适宜NDF水平提供参考。选用36只湖羊公羔,随机分为15%和25%NDF水平组。56日龄时,每组选择6只羔羊屠宰,称量组织器官质量,并测定相关基因的表达量。结果表明:不同NDF水平开食料对组织器官的质量和指数均无显著影响(P>0.05);NDF水平15%组羔羊下丘脑生长激素释放激素(GHRH)、肝脏胰岛素样生长因子-1(IGF-1)、十二指肠IGF-1和十二指肠胰岛素样生长因子1受体(IGF-1R)表达量均显著高于25%组(P<0.05);NDF水平25%组垂体生长激素(GH)和十二指肠生长激素受体(GHR)表达量极显著高于15%组(P<0.01);羔羊平均日增质量与下丘脑GHRH表达量极显著负相关(P<0.01)、与肝脏GHR、十二指肠IGF-1表达量显著负相关(P<0.05),与垂体GH、十二指肠GHR表达量显著正相关(P<0.05);垂体GH与肝脏GHR、IGF-1、十二指肠IGF-1、IGF-1R表达量显著或极显著负相关(P<0.05或P<0.01),与十二指肠GHR表达量极显著正相关(P<0.01);肝脏GHR与肝脏IGF-1、十二指肠IGF-1表达量极显著正相关(P<0.01),与十二指肠GHR表达量极显著负相关(P<0.01)。综上所述,与15%水平组相比,饲喂25%NDF水平开食料更能提高羔羊生长轴GH-GHR水平相关基因的表达。The aim of this trial was to investigate the effect of different levels of NDF on the expression of genes related to growth axis and duodenal growth in lambs,in order to provide a reference for the appropriate NDF level for lamb starter.Thirty-six male Hu lambs were selected for the trial and randomly divided into 15%and 25%NDF level groups.At 56 days of age,six lambs from each group were selected for slaughter,weighed for tissue and organ,and the expression of relevant genes was measured.The results showed that there was no significant effect(P>0.05)of NDF levels in the starter diet on tissue and organ mass and index;in the 15%group of lambs,hypothalamic growth hormone releasing hormone(GHRH),hepatic insulin-like growth factor-1(IGF-1),duodenal IGF-1 and IGF-1 receptor(IGF-1R)expressions were significantly higher in the 25%group(P<0.05);the expression of pituitary growth hormone(GH)and growth hormone receptor(GHR)in the duodenum were significantly higher in the 25%group than in the 15%group(P<0.01).The average daily gain of lambs was strongly negatively correlated with hypothalamic GHRH expression(P<0.01),significantly negatively correlated with hepatic GHR and duodenal IGF-1 expression(P<0.05),and significantly positively correlated with pituitary GH and duodenal GHR expression(P<0.05);pituitary GH was significantly or highly significantly negatively correlated with hepatic GHR,IGF-1,duodenal IGF-1 and IGF-1R expression(P<0.05 or P<0.01),and strongly significantly positively correlated with duodenal GHR expression(P<0.01);hepatic GHR was strongly significantly positively correlated with hepatic IGF-1,duodenal IGF-1 expression(P<0.01),and strongly significantly negatively correlated with duodenal GHR expression(P<0.01).In conclusion,the expression of genes related to GH-GHR levels in the growth axis of lambs is enhanced by feeding 25%NDF level open feed compared to the 15%level group.
